2021 Autumn Child-rearing Knowledge Training for Small Classes

The following is the content of the 2021 autumn kindergarten child rearing knowledge training: * * 1. Health and diet ** 1. * * Drinking Water ** - Autumn was dry, and children were prone to symptoms of autumn dryness. Their lung function was affected and they might have dry coughs. To let the child drink more water to replenish the body's water, it is best to drink plain water. In kindergarten, the child can consciously drink water after exercise, after class, after getting up, and after outdoor activities. However, at home, parents should urge the picky child to drink more water. 2. * * Food ** - Fruits and vegetables: Give the child more vegetables and fruits that have the effect of nourishing yin and lungs, such as sugar cane and pears, but pay attention to the appropriate amount to avoid hurting the spleen and stomach and causing stomach discomfort. Also, choose fresh fruits and vegetables to help drive away the autumn dryness. - Autumn dryness prevention porridge: Autumn dryness may cause the child's body fluid deficiency. Porridge has the effect of clearing fire, nourishing the stomach, and strengthening the spleen. When cooking porridge, you can add pears, radishes, sesame seeds and other food that can nourish the lungs, which can effectively improve the discomfort caused by autumn dryness. - * * Anti-dryness and Nourishing Yin Food **: It is suitable for nourishing Yin in autumn and winter. You can give the child Chinese yam, lotus root, and other anti-dryness and Nourishing Yin foods. The Chinese yam could strengthen the spleen, nourish the lungs, nourish the kidney essence, and nourish the five internal organs, while the lotus root could stimulate the appetite and strengthen the spleen. * * 2. Dressing ** 1. * * Increase or decrease clothes ** - Children should wear more clothes in the morning and evening than during the day. Parents could train their children at home. Don't give your child too much clothes. Adding too much clothes too early may cause a "hot cold", but it's not to pursue "cool". It should be added appropriately. If one wore too much clothes in kindergarten, they would sweat easily after a little exercise, causing the child to catch a cold. For children who are active and easy to sweat, put a towel on their back when playing or change their clothes in time after playing. At the same time, children's shoes should be light sports shoes and wear less leather shoes. 2. * * Quilt problem ** - The weather in autumn was sometimes cold and sometimes hot. If the child's quilt was too thick or too thin, it would not be conducive to an afternoon nap. Parents should take the child's quilt home to wash and dry it in time according to the life teacher's notice. * * 3. Safety and Living Habits ** 1. * * The slide is safe ** - Children should not be taught to slide backwards, because when they slide backwards, their heads hit the ground first, and the impact was borne by their heads. In addition, if they hit the ground, they would suffer a concussion, or a minor injury to the scalp. 2. * * Self-care Ability Training ** - Parents should work with the kindergarten to train their children's self-care ability, such as teaching them to put on and take off their clothes in time, learning to tuck their clothes into their pants to prevent their stomachs from catching a cold. * * 4. Cooperation between the kindergarten and the family ** 1. * * Health Notification ** - If the child is not feeling well, the parents must inform the teacher so that the teacher can observe and take care of him during the day's activities. If the child needed to be fed medicine in the kindergarten, he should bring the medicine to the doctor when he entered the kindergarten. Reflection and Evaluation on the Adaptability Training Program for the Freshmen in Small Classes

The following is the reflection and evaluation of the adaptation training program for the freshmen in the small class: ** I. Reflection on the adaptation training program ** 1. ** In terms of achieving goals ** - In order to help the freshmen familiarize themselves with the kindergarten environment and daily processes, if the training program included activities such as entering the kindergarten and understanding the functions of different areas of the classroom, these activities would help the freshmen adapt to the new environment quickly. For example, if there was a special " Know My Classroom " activity, freshmen could find their towels and cups faster, enhance their sense of belonging to the kindergarten, and achieve the goal of adapting to the environment. - In terms of social interaction goals, activities such as organizing group games were effective in promoting new students to interact with their peers. However, some children might be too shy or afraid to participate fully. For example, in the " Find Friends " game, there might be children who were afraid to introduce themselves to other children. This indicated that the guidance and encouragement mechanism for these children in the training program might need to be strengthened. - In terms of the cultivation of living habits, such as training in life skills such as washing hands and queuing, although most children can gradually learn under guidance, the timing may not be reasonable enough. For example, during the hand-washing session, due to the tight schedule, some children could not completely master the correct hand-washing steps and needed to adjust the rhythm of the training. 2. ** Event content and format ** - If the content of the activity was too singular, such as focusing on indoor activities and lacking outdoor exploration, it might reduce the child's interest in kindergarten life. A variety of activities such as stories, children's songs, games, etc. would attract children more. However, if the game design was too complicated, it would be more difficult for the younger students to understand and participate, which would affect their enthusiasm. - In terms of guiding children to adapt to separation anxiety, some activities such as accompanying parents to the kindergarten for a period of time were positive. However, when the parents left, the child might still have a strong emotional reaction, indicating that the design of this transition activity still needed to be optimized, such as increasing the trust between the teacher and the child. 3. ** Teacher's guidance role ** - Teachers played a key role in the adaptation training. If the teacher could guide the child warmly and patiently, it would be of great help to the child's adaptation process. However, in practice, due to the large number of children, teachers could not give enough attention to each child, resulting in the special needs of some children being neglected. - The way the teacher encouraged the child to actively participate in activities was also very important. If it was just a simple verbal encouragement, the effect might be limited. Teachers could use more personal ways of encouragement, such as giving children who performed well small sticker or letting children act as assistants. ** 2. Evaluation ** 1. ** Overall evaluation of the training program ** - The overall framework of the adaptation training program for the freshmen in this small class was reasonable, covering many aspects such as environmental adaptation, social interaction, and the cultivation of living habits. However, the details still needed to be further optimized to better meet the needs of each child. - The design of the plan reflected the consideration of the characteristics of the freshmen in the small class, such as the use of simple and easy-to-understand games. However, there was still room for improvement in the depth and breadth of the activities. For example, more cultural and artistic elements could be added to enrich the children's kindergarten experience. 2. ** Evaluation of the child's adaptability ** - Most of the children could basically adapt to the pace of life in the kindergarten after the adaptation training, such as eating on time and taking an afternoon nap. However, in terms of emotional stability, some children still had large fluctuations and needed to continue to pay attention and guide them in their daily activities. - From the perspective of social development, some children were already able to actively interact with their peers, but there were still many children who were in a wait-and-see state. They needed more encouragement and guidance to promote them to establish good interpersonal relationships in kindergarten. 3. ** Evaluation of the implementation of training programs by teachers ** - Teachers showed high professionalism in the implementation of training programs and were able to actively guide children to participate in various activities. However, there was still a need to further improve the ability to deal with the special circumstances of individual children to ensure that every child could receive sufficient attention and support during the adaptation training. - Teachers 'creativity in adaptation training still needed to be improved. An Analysis of the Art Class Activity in the Small Classes of the Nurseries

The following is an analysis of the art class activities in the kindergarten: ##1. Teaching Plan ###(1) Activity Target 1. ** Skill Target ** - Children can master basic art creation skills, such as learning to dip their fingers in paint to draw on paper in the finger painting activity, and learning to stick leaves in a specific position to present a specific object (tree) in the leaf sticking activity. - Able to have a preliminary understanding of color and use it, such as distinguishing different colors of paint (red, yellow, green, etc.) or the color of leaves for creation. 2. ** Emotions, interests, goals ** - To stimulate children's interest in art activities, so that they are willing to participate in art creation and enjoy the creative process. - Cultivate the habit of drawing carefully, keeping the picture clean and tidy, and the sense of cooperation in cooperative activities (such as leaf sticking group cooperation). 3. ** Awareness goal ** - Through art creation, children can have a deeper understanding of art materials (paint, leaves, brushes, paper, etc.). - In the process of creation, understand the basic forms of objects (such as flowers, trees, etc.). ###(2) Difficulties of the activity 1. ** Main point ** - In the finger painting, the focus was to let the children learn to use their fingers to dip in the paint to draw, and in the leaf sticking activity, the focus was to master the method of leaf sticking. 2. ** Difficulty ** - In finger painting, it was difficult to draw different flowers (such as different sizes, shapes, etc.) with fingers, and in the leaf sticking activity, it might be difficult for children to arrange the leaves reasonably to express the beauty of the big tree. ###(3) Event preparation 1. ** Material preparation ** - For finger painting, prepare red, yellow, and green colors, a children's picture album, and a self-made PowerPoint. For the leaf sticking activity, prepare all kinds of leaves, paste, and rags picked up from the walk. Prepare painted tree branches (the number of trees is the same as the number of children in the group) and arrange them on the wall. 2. [Knowledge preparation] - The teacher gave the children some simple guidance in advance, such as observing the shape of flowers and trees. ###(4) Activity process 1. ** Part of the import ** - Take the season as the starting point. For example, with spring as the background in the finger painting, by showing spring-related PowerPoint (such as willow sprouting in spring, grass emerging, colorful flowers, etc.), it can arouse the interest of children. The leaf sticking activity can start from the autumn leaves and show the collected leaves to guide children to experience the beauty of autumn leaves, thus leading to the theme of the activity. 2. ** Demonstrations and explanations ** - Finger Pointing: The teacher first demonstrated how to draw a grass on a piece of paper with a finger dipped in green paint (from bottom to top), then dipped his finger in a little red or yellow paint to draw a flower on the grass, guiding the child to think about how to express the different sizes of the flower (such as by discussing the different ways to draw the stamen and the fully open flower). - Leaf Sticking: Teach the child how to stick leaves. Choose a leaf that you like and apply paste on the back of the leaf. Stick it around the branches (emphasize that the more you stick, the better, so that the tree is covered with leaves). 3. ** Children's Creation ** - The children would draw with their fingers or paste leaves to create, and the teacher would guide them on a tour. In the finger painting, help the children with weak ability to master the method of drawing grass and flowers, encourage the children with strong ability to boldly use colors to enrich the picture; When sticking leaves, remind the children to pay attention to the amount of paste, encourage the children to stick boldly, choose the same color of leaves to stick in different places on the branches, and guide the children to work together to stick the big tree (a group of children work together to paste a tree in autumn). 4. ** Exhibition and Evaluation Section ** - Posting children's works, children can enjoy the color, size, shape and other elements in the works together. Let the children self-evaluate and evaluate each other. The teacher will give positive feedback and guidance, such as affirming the child's performance in color selection, picture cleanliness, creativity, and so on. ##2. Reflection 1. ** Success ** - ** Achievement of goals **: From the children's works and participation, most of the children can achieve the skill requirements in the activity goals, such as completing the basic creative movements in the finger painting and leaf sticking activities. In terms of emotion and interest, the children showed high enthusiasm in the process of the activity. Their interest in art activities was stimulated, and they had a certain sense of cooperation in cooperative activities. In terms of cognition, children had a more intuitive understanding of art materials and a deeper understanding of the shapes of objects such as flowers and trees. - ** Teaching methods **: Use intuitive teaching methods, such as PowerPoint presentation, teacher demonstration, etc., in line with the cognitive characteristics of small class children. By asking questions and guiding children to discuss, they could inspire children to think. For example, guiding children to discuss the size of flowers in finger painting could cultivate children's thinking ability to a certain extent. - ** Event organization **: The activities are compact and the transition is natural. The introduction part could attract the children's attention and stimulate their interest; the demonstration was clear and clear, so that the children could understand the creation method; when the children were creating, the teacher's itinerant guidance was timely and effective; the children could actively participate in the exhibition and evaluation of the works, enhancing their self-confidence and expression ability. 2. ** Inadequacies ** - ** Not enough attention to individual differences **: Although there is some guidance for individual children with weak abilities in the activities, we can pay more attention to the individual differences between children. For example, some children might need more time and more detailed guidance to master the skills in finger painting. In the leaf sticking activity, some children might need more guidance in the leaf layout and creativity. - ** Material variety **: In art activities, the variety of materials can be further expanded. For example, in finger painting, in addition to the three colors of red, yellow, and green, more colors could be added, or different kinds of paper could be provided to let the child feel different creative effects. In the leaf sticking activity, some auxiliary materials could be added, such as colored paper strips, twigs, etc., so that the child had more room for creativity. 3. ** Modification measures ** - ** Individual differences **: In future activities, the children's art ability can be assessed in advance. According to the assessment results, the children will be divided into groups of different levels, and more targeted guidance will be provided to each group during the activity. For children with weaker abilities, individual tutoring could be conducted before the activity, or more attention and patient guidance could be given during the activity. - ** Enrich the variety of materials **: When preparing the materials for the art event, consider the variety of materials. For example, in the finger painting, increase the types of paint and paper of different texture; in the leaf sticking activity, collect more types of leaves, prepare colorful paper strips, twigs, dried flowers and other auxiliary materials to stimulate the creativity and imagination of children. Parenting knowledge, small classroom, kindergarten, small class, learning

There were many aspects of learning in a small kindergarten class: ** 1. Living habits and self-care ability ** 1. ** Personal Item Management ** - After taking off your shoes, place them neatly. Put your socks inside your shoes. - He could drink water from his own cup. - After playing with the toys, he put them away in the designated location in time. 2. ** Health Habits ** - Wash your hands before eating, after using the toilet, and when your hands are dirty. - Don't drink raw water and drink less beverages. - Girls should squat down to relieve themselves, queue up to go to the toilet, and pay attention to privacy; boys and girls should not relieve themselves anywhere, and do not row their urine outside the pool. They should tell the teacher in time when they relieve themselves, and gradually learn to take care of themselves, such as wiping their own buttocks, lifting their pants, etc. 3. ** Eating Habits ** - When eating, hold the bowl, chew carefully and swallow slowly. Postures are correct to avoid dirtying clothes. Don't make food everywhere. Obey table manners. Don't fight, don't snatch, and don't be picky about food. 4. ** Habits ** - Enter the park on time, not be late, and not leave early. - She could go to bed on time and not cry or make a fuss. ** 2. In terms of social and behavior norms ** 1. ** Interact with others ** - He did not snatch other people's toys and stationery. - Learn to make friends, remember the names of teachers and good friends, know how to share, willing to share their favorite toys with others, and share happy things with classmates and teachers. - Obey the rules when playing games with your classmates. Don't shout or push other children. - He took the initiative to socialize with children and learn to express himself through making friends. - If you affect others, you have to apologize. If you break a classmate's things, you have to compensate. - Learn how to help others and thank them when you receive help. - Able to briefly communicate with parents about their daily life and activities in the kindergarten that day. Able to clearly explain what happened if there was a problem. - During the event, he would listen, dare to express himself, be willing to communicate, be able to use materials to operate, and dare to perform in front of others. - Able to greet and say goodbye to classmates, parents, and teachers. 2. ** Code of conduct ** - They did not hit, curse, pinch, or bite people. - Obey public etiquette and not make a racket in public. - Civilization car first get off and then get on, do not push. - Don't eat or drink anything given by strangers. If you get lost, ask the police for help. Don't say no when others are unhappy. ** 3. Learning and Awareness ** 1. ** Safety Awareness ** - Pay attention to safety when playing sports equipment. Be careful when going up and down the stairs. Don't play around in the stairwell. Watch out for obstacles when walking. Be careful not to slip. Know the safety signs and understand the basic traffic rules. 2. ** Basic Knowledge Learning ** - To recognize circles, squares, and triangles, to classify objects according to a characteristic of the object, to learn how to classify objects within five groups according to their size, length, and a certain characteristic, to recognize "1" and "many" and their relationship, to correspond the number to 1 - 5, to compare the number of two groups of objects using a one-to-one correspondence method, to take objects according to the number, to perceive more, less, and the same number. - With himself as the center, he could differentiate between up, down, front, back, left, right, inside, outside, and other directions. - In the field of language, listening to stories to develop the habit of listening to develop language comprehension ability, reading books to cultivate interest in reading; In the field of science, to stimulate curiosity and the desire to explore to develop cognitive ability; In the field of society, to cultivate interpersonal communication and social adaptability; In the field of art, painting, singing children's songs, doing crafts, to cultivate beauty. ** 4. Self-protection and expression ** 1. ** Self-protection ** - He memorized his parents 'cell phone numbers and home addresses. - If you feel unwell, you can tell the teacher in time. 2. ** Expressiveness ** - He likes to answer questions and raise questions. He can boldly express his thoughts during discussions. When answering questions or speaking in class, he raises his hand first. Safety Training in Nurseries

In 2022, several kindergarten activities related to production safety training were carried out. For example, at noon on September 8,2022, Yulin Experimental kindergarten invited Instructor Wang Shenghu of Yulin City Science and Education Center to carry out fire safety training with the theme of "abiding by the Safety Production Law and being the first responsible person" for all the teaching and staff. The instructor explained the importance of fire safety through real fire accident cases, explained fire prevention, fire self-rescue and escape, and also taught and demonstrated the use and maintenance of fire equipment. On September 17,2022, the Education and Sports Bureau of Pingluo County held safety training for primary and secondary schools and kindergarten in the whole county. The training targets were the deputy school heads in charge of safety in primary and secondary schools and kindergarten in the whole county. The aim was to enhance the safety awareness of the school safety leaders and the ability to deal with emergencies through training. <a href="/?from=ask_words" style="color:red" target="_blank">Read more exciting novels for free</a>
